Keyboard Shortcuts
A keyboard connected to the USB 1.1 port of a Decoder can be used to change the assigned Encoder to
another one. Thus, the input source of a Decoder can be changed quickly and easily.
INFO:
The Video Stream ID of the Decoder is changed when a command is executed.
The shortcut can be set:
▪
to select a certain stream directly, or
▪
toselectthenext/previousstreaminthelist.
Setting (Changing) a Shortcut
Step 1. Open the web page of the desired Decoder and navigate to the Advanced Settings page.
Step 2. Connect an USB keyboard to that computer directly, or through the desired Decoder and the Encoder
(make sure the Encoder is connected to the computer via USB).
Step 3. Place the cursor in the desired Shortcut box.
Step 4. Press the desired key combination; the new setting will be displayed and stored.
Executing a Command (Calling a Shortcut)
Connect the keyboard to an USB 1.1 port (not the USB 2.0!) of the desired Decoder. Press the key(s) three times
quickly(within750ms).
